Visual Studio 是一款由微軟官方推出的最新款專業(yè)化VS編程開發(fā)工具,增添了包括 Live Code 和 IntelliCode 等新功能的改進,編程人員用了它以后可以非常輕松地進行編程操作。Visual Studio增加了新的搜索體驗,搜索框允許你查找設置、命令和安裝選項,還支持模糊搜索,拼錯單詞也可以找到所需的結(jié)果。此外,VS還具備一個源代碼編輯器功能,從此編輯和調(diào)試C++、PHP代碼不再是難事。華軍軟件園為您提供Visual Studio免費下載!
-
多文件編輯查看
-
程序員必備查看
-
指令加亮顯示查看
Visual Studio 軟件特色
一、使用VSTS加快從構想到發(fā)布的進程
1、CI/CD
使用高性能管道以閃電般的速度測試代碼并將其部署到生產(chǎn)。 根據(jù)需要開始處理小型任務和縱向擴展。
2、Agile
開始按自己的方式實現(xiàn)敏捷方法。 VSTS 提供可配置看板、交互式積壓工作 (backlog)、簡單易用的計劃工具和對 Scrum 的全新支持,它將所有這些功能集成到一起,以獲得卓越的可跟蹤性和報告體驗。
3、Git
VSTS 具有你所喜愛的 GIt 所具有的全部功能,并具有免費的專用存儲庫、拉取請求和代碼評審。 與同事合作,使你的代碼堅實可靠,并與 CI/CD 集成,將代碼快速用于生產(chǎn)。
4、程序包
編碼一次即可在組織中共享程序包。 使用 VSTS 托管專用 Nuget、npm 和 Maven 包,以獲取更可靠、可縮放的內(nèi)部版本。
5、測試
提前測試并增加測試頻率,信心十足地發(fā)布。 使用 VSTS 設置測試計劃并跟蹤和報告手動測試、運行自動執(zhí)行的測試套件,并運行基于云的負載測試。
二、部署到任意平臺
無論是已就緒任務還是自定義任務,都可以使用現(xiàn)有 DevOps 基礎結(jié)構將應用程序部署到任何平臺、云提供商或應用商店。
三、VSTS 適用于你的工具
用團隊最喜愛的語言、IDE 和 DevOps 工具鏈(不論它們是否來自 Microsoft)生成應用程序。
四、部署到 Azure
為應用程序創(chuàng)建完整的 CI/CD 管道(不論使用的是哪種語言)并部署到多個目標,其中包括虛擬機、Azure Service Fabric 和 Docker 容器業(yè)務流程(如 Kubernetes)。
五、安全??煽?。持續(xù)更新。
VSTS 適用于企業(yè),它受 99.9% SLA 和全天候支持,在發(fā)布后(每 3 周)獲取新功能。
六、使用 TFS? 立即遷移到 VSTS
將團隊和數(shù)據(jù)移動到 VSTS 以便隨時隨地進行連接并盡享每三周發(fā)布一次的最新更新。 無需升級。
七、由 Gartner 認可
Gartner 基于 Microsoft 的執(zhí)行能力和愿景完整性,認可它是 2017 企業(yè)敏捷規(guī)劃工具魔力象限領導者。
八、集成和擴展
Visual Studio Marketplace 具有 500 多項擴展,這些擴展將 VSTS 與你的現(xiàn)有工具無縫集成。
Visual Studio 軟件功能
1、開發(fā):編寫沒什么錯誤的代碼
遇到困難時使用 IntelliSense 代碼建議快速準確地鍵入變量。 無論導航到所需的任何文件、類型、成員或符號聲明時的復雜程度如何,都保持一定的速度。 使用建議操作(例如重命名函數(shù)或添加參數(shù))的燈泡快速改進代碼。
2、分析:了解有關代碼的詳細信息
CodeLens 幫助你輕松找到重要見解,例如對代碼所做的更改、這些更改的影響以及是否對方法進行了單元測試。 可一目了然地查看參考、作者、測試、提交歷史記錄和其他重要信息。
3、測試:有效工作
輕松導航和組織測試套件,以便分析測試的代碼量并立即查看結(jié)果。 立即了解所做的每個更改的影響,并讓高級功能在你鍵入代碼時對其進行測試。 在錯誤發(fā)生時立即修復錯誤,并查看現(xiàn)有測試是否覆蓋了新更改。
4、debug:快速找到并修復 bug
借助vs2019可以使用斷點和所需方法在要檢查 bug 時暫停代碼執(zhí)行。 如果一步過長或遇到了意外的更改,可以回退到任何特定代碼行,而無需重啟會話或重新創(chuàng)建狀態(tài)。
5、協(xié)作:共享多個屏幕
無論語言或平臺如何,都可以使用 Live Share 通過快速自然地協(xié)作來領導團隊,以共同實時編輯和調(diào)試。 通過強制每個用戶使用一致的編碼樣式的訪問控制和自定義編輯器設置來個性化會話。
6、部署:針對云進行構建
使用適用于常見應用程序類型和本地 Azure 仿真程序的模板快速啟動和運行,而無需 Azure 帳戶。 還可以預配應用程序依賴項(例如 Azure SQL 數(shù)據(jù)庫和 Azure 存儲帳戶),而無需離開 Visual Studio。 使用直接附加到應用程序的 Visual Studio 遠程調(diào)試器快速診斷任何問題。
Visual Studio 新版功能
IDE
現(xiàn)已公開發(fā)布 Visual Studio IntelliCode,并且可以隨任何支持 C#、C++、TypeScipt/JavaScript 或 XAML 的任意工作負載一起安裝
添加了對 Per-Monitor Awareness 的支持
新的 codefixes 可用于 C#
最近使用已添加到 Visual Studio 搜索
調(diào)試器
改進 Source Link 身份驗證
將 nuget.org 符號服務器添加到默認符號服務器列表中
Time Travel Debugging 預覽版現(xiàn)在包括異常單步執(zhí)行支持
擴展性
在 VSIX 項目中刪除了對 .resx 文件的需求(BuildTools 更新)
VSIX 項目模板現(xiàn)在使用新的 SDK 版本
性能
性能優(yōu)化,縮短解決方案加載時間
模板作者可以向其模板添加自定義標簽
現(xiàn)在 CodeLens 支持自定義 UI
更新了語言服務器協(xié)議
優(yōu)化了在解決方案、文件夾和其他視圖之間的切換行為
C++
添加了 CMake 的編輯器內(nèi)文檔
無需額外配置或 SSH 連接,即可在 Visual Studio 中以本機方式將本地適用于 Linux 的 Windows 子系統(tǒng) (WSL) 安裝與 C++ 結(jié)合使用
AddressSanitizer 現(xiàn)已集成到 Visual Studio,以用于 Linux 項目和 WSL
改進并修改了 C++ Quick Info 工具提示中的著色
實現(xiàn)了新的 C++ 代碼分析快速修復
F#
為 F# 和 F# 工具發(fā)布了更多性能改進和大量錯誤修復
.NET
新的 .NET 生產(chǎn)力功能包括項目和解決方案上的一鍵式代碼清理、新的切換塊注釋鍵盤快捷鍵、重構以將類型移動到其他名稱空間等
現(xiàn)在可以通過開始窗口中的克隆屏幕從 SSH URI 克隆代碼
此版本中的 .NET 生產(chǎn)力新增功能包括無插入類型的 intellisense 完成、切換單行注釋/取消注釋、將命名樣式導出到 editorconfig,以及用于優(yōu)先使用 namspace 內(nèi)部/外部的新代碼樣式設置
.NET SDK 工具新增功能,主要包括支持 .NET Core 3.0 的 WinForms 和 WPF 項目,以及 Bug 修復和性能改進
Visual Studio SDK v16.0 已發(fā)布到 NuGet
適用于 .NET Core 3.0 WPF 開發(fā)的 XAML 設計器預覽版已可用
Xamarin
Xamarin 的默認 Android 體驗現(xiàn)在支持 API 28
Xamarin.Forms XAML 建議設計時間屬性
Visual Studio常見問題
代碼編寫與調(diào)試問題
利用VS Code的代碼檢查功能來發(fā)現(xiàn)語法錯誤。
仔細閱讀錯誤信息,根據(jù)提示定位問題所在。
使用調(diào)試工具逐步執(zhí)行代碼,觀察變量的值和程序的執(zhí)行流程。
檢查配置文件(如launch.json和tasks.json)是否正確配置,以確保調(diào)試器能夠正確運行。
Visual Studio更新日志:
1.優(yōu)化內(nèi)容
2.細節(jié)更出眾,bug去無蹤
華軍小編推薦:
Visual Studio這款軟件操作簡單,功能強大,輕松簡單,可以下載試試哦,歡迎大家下載,本站還提供快表軟件、河小象編程客戶端、自動化測試工具AutoRunner、Easy GUI、小海龜LOGO語言等供您下載。
您的評論需要經(jīng)過審核才能顯示